European Yew

Taxus baccata

Thin pale sapwood; heartwood orangish brown sometimes with darker/purplish hue; darkens with age.

European yew (Taxus baccata) is a slow-growing, fine-textured softwood with a distinctive orange‑brown heartwood and pale sapwood. It’s traditionally used for bows, turning, carving, and small decorative work; it can be very durable but is difficult to source in large clear sizes.
